Balancing speed and quality in fast first aid courses

There is a point where a course ends up being too "fast" and quality experiences. From an instructor's viewpoint, there are a couple of warnings:

If the schedule enables much less than about 90 minutes of hands-on practice for CPR and AED make use of combined, skill retention will certainly be poor. Individuals may pass the assessment but will not really feel comfy in an actual emergency.

If the course size is as well huge relative to the number of manikins and trainers, students end up viewing greater than doing. In first aid and CPR training classes, everyone requires multiple complete cycles of compressions and breaths, not just a token 30 seconds.

If the material feels like a rapid slide show of every feasible problem with no time for situation method, you may win expertise yet without useful fluency. Fast first aid courses must narrow range to core issues and pierce those well, as opposed to skim everything.

On the other hand, there is something as excessively long training that wears down students and weakens focus. I have actually seen 8 hour first aid courses where the last 2 hours include every person slogging with tests while calmly wishing the clock to run out.

The wonderful place for numerous active grownups is blended shipment: online, self-paced lessons covering composition, legal responsibilities, and low-risk topics, followed by a focused functional session of 2 to 4 hours. This style appreciates grownups' time while maintaining standards high.

Special emphasis: express childcare very first aid

Childcare and very early understanding settings have a certain risk profile. Younger children can not explain their symptoms well. They discover by placing objects into their mouths. They have smaller sized respiratory tracts and various physiology. Personnel handle responsibility of look after multiple children at once.

An express child care first aid course requires to recognize that reality. The core abilities coincide first aid and CPR concepts, however adapted.

Paediatric CPR technique is various: smaller sized hands, various compression depth, gentle head tilt. Choking administration in babies and small children uses thoroughly controlled back blows and chest thrusts, not just scaled-down adult methods.

Allergic reactions and anaphylaxis are extra typical in this age group. Educators must know just how to recognise early indications, use EpiPens or comparable tools, and take care of the disorderly few mins while waiting for a rescue and comforting various other children.

Head injuries from drops, febrile convulsions, consumption of non-food items, and play ground fractures all include more greatly in express child care first aid training than in a common first aid course.

Keeping skills fresh with fast CPR refresher courses

CPR is a physical skill. It decomposes over time, just like any strategy you do not exercise. Research recommends that efficiency begins to go down within months if there is no refresh, even if your formal certificate stays valid for one or more years.

For that factor, I encourage institutions and clubs to deal with fast cpr refresher courses as a yearly ritual as opposed to an administrative second thought. Short, concentrated refreshers that compete one to 2 hours and concentrate only on apprehension acknowledgment, compressions, breaths, and AED usage can suit personnel meetings or preseason preparation evenings.

You do not require to duplicate a complete first aid course each year. Rather, a cycle functions well: full first aid and CPR training in year one, express cpr training or refresher in year two, after that an incorporated first aid and CPR course in year 3 to reset understanding and certificates.

Between formal courses, micro-practice assists retention. 2 mins of compressions on a manikin borrowed from a neighborhood supplier, quick "what would certainly you do?" circumstances at personnel rundowns, or perhaps mental wedding rehearsal when you pass the AED cupboard keeps neural pathways warm.
